title = "Electrochemical deposition of metallic nanowires as a scanning probe tip",
abstract = "This paper describes Ni electrodeposition for producing metallic nanowires as a nanoprobe tip. A polycarbonate porous membrane was used as a template for the growth of nanowires on a Si AFM probe tip. A focused ion beam (FIB) was used to deposit a thin Pt layer as the cathode with a controlled small area on the tip apex and the underlying membrane surface. The produced nanowire-AFM probe showed compatibility with a conventional AFM system. We also demonstrated deposition of Al2O3 by atomic layer deposition (ALD) into the template with the aim of decreasing the nanowire diameters.",
